چکیده

Transmission properties through sharp rectangular waveguide bends are investigated to determine the cut-off bending angles of the wave propagation. We show that a simple metallic diaphragm at the bending corner with properly devised sub-wavelength defect apertures of C-slits would be readily to turn on the transmissions with scarce reflections of the propagating modes, while preserving the integrity of the transmitting fields soon after the bends. In particularly, our design also demonstrates the capability of eliminating all the unwanted cavity resonant transmissions that exist in the three-dimensional cascade sharp waveguide bends, and solely let the desired signals travel along the whole passage of the waveguide. The present approach, using C-slit diaphragms to support the sharp bending behaviors of the guided waves with greatly enhanced transmissions, would be especially effective in constructing novel waveguides and pave the way for the development of more compact and miniaturized electromagnetic systems that exploit these waveguide bends.

Air Trenches for Sharp Silica Waveguide Bends

Air trench structures for reduced-size bends in lowindex contrast waveguides are proposed. To minimize junction loss, the structures are designed to provide adiabatic mode shaping between lowand high-index contrast regions, which is achieved by the introduction of “cladding tapers.” Drastic reduction in effective bend radius is predicted.
